          A man went to interview for a new job. The interviewer said that the company was looking for people who were responsible. The man said, “That’s me. In my last three jobs, whenever anything went wrongs, they said I was responsible!” It is common, human nature, to blame others for our own sin, but ultimately, our actions are our own and we are responsible for them.
        After King Ahab died in battle, his son, Ahaziah, ascended to the throne. The example he had from his father and mother was one of rejecting God and worshiping Baal. He had seen the power of God displayed on Mt. Carmel when Elijah had the showdown with the prophets of Baal and God showed Himself in a mighty and dynamic way. He had known of the prophecy that his father would die in battle and saw it come true though Ahab tried to hide. However, he chose to walk in his father’s ways and God would hold him accountable. Live with awareness that sees and knows you and seek to live out His purposes for you each day.
